I have a 2002 escalade(AWD), and right at about 100,000 my front diff. went out completey. The dealer couldn't locate a new one, and I had a few repair shops try to locate a new one for me also. The dealer ended up rebuilding the one I had. And nformed me It would cost more for a rebuild(parts and labor). Long/short; I paid close to $2200, so if you are getting a new Diff. I would have to say you are getting a good deal.
